Web30 nov. 2024 · Some popular anti-inflammatory foods include fruits and vegetables; nuts; seeds; herbs and spices; and fatty fish. All of these foods offer a variety of nutrients, antioxidants, and phytochemicals that can help protect against inflammation. Eating a diet rich in anti-inflammatory foods can help to improve your overall health and well-being. Web4 sep. 2024 · On one hand, some fruits are antioxidants and anti-inflammatory.
